
Drina River House, Bajina Basta, Serbia
Many people visit Tara National Park in Bajina Basta from Serbia but not all of them know the origins of the Drina River House. This interesting house was built perched on a stone, apparently built by a group of swimmers in the 1960s. They used to spend their summer vacation there and it was the perfect place for resting and relaxation.
The house was built because the level of the river kept rising and the materials had to be brought by boat. However, over time the house remained on the stone and became one of the most visited places in Serbia.
